for some reason i cant find that option on my touch pro?? any help ?
"7 deadly", when u tap configure picturemail, theres an option to "tap to add". what u could do is go to start/settings/system/remove programs. here u can uninstall any previous sprint picmail or sMMS. now you should not have either installed.
now u can download and install the cab i attached to this post.
after that go to start/programs/configure picturemail tap the icon that says "tap to add"
now u will have to options for photobucket, my space, facebook, youtube, sprint online album(s)...HTH
